Output 880921c34315c28e6872b7ba5383ce36670608ddc6d1c5ddfe12c5144f4f9f83:0

value
107765949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74eec2b7e9ece7c6ae0449bf42aa21407c4bc21d OP_EQUAL
address
3CMJLB5yKEAy3bso65G3QfBuDznpgv24MS
transaction
880921c34315c28e6872b7ba5383ce36670608ddc6d1c5ddfe12c5144f4f9f83
spent
true